Miami-based food entrepreneur dies in Samburu helicopter crash

Roger Duarte, 42, was the founder of George Stone Crab, a business that sold fresh Florida stone crab claws. He also co-founded My Ceviche, a seafood restaurant chain...

A Miami-based food entrepreneur, Roger Duarte, was among seven people who tragically died when a helicopter crashed near Mount Ololokwe in Samburu County on Wednesday.
- Seven people died in the crash.
- The victims included Roger Duarte, founder of George Stone Crab and co-founder of My Ceviche.
- The helicopter, an Eurocopter EC130 B4 operated by Lady Lori Kenya Ltd, was carrying tourists from Loisaba to Ewaso Nyiro.
